Frequently Asked Questions about River Oaks

What type of rentals are currently available in River Oaks?

There are currently 34 Apartments for Rent in River Oaks,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,125 to $2,800. There are also 48 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in River Oaks ranging from $845 to $3,995.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in River Oaks?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in River Oaks ranges from $845 to $3,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,197.
